Polycrystalline Solar Panel: Definition, How it

Polycrystalline, multicrystalline, or poly solar panels are a type of photovoltaic (PV) panel used to generate electricity from sunlight. They are the second most common residential solar panel type after monocrystalline panels.

Why PV panels must be recycled at the end of their

Polycrystalline silicon PV panels have a 55% market share in crystalline silicon technology and monocrystalline silicon PV panels have a 45% market share in crystalline silicon technology. Solar panels Data Sheet

Solar panels work on the principle of the photovoltaic effect. The photovoltaic effect is the conversion of sunlight into electricity. This occurs when the PV cell is struck by photons (sunlight), ''freeing'' silicon electrons to travel from the PV cell, through electronic circuitry, to a load (Figure 1). Monocrystalline vs Polycrystalline Solar Panels

This is due to the fact that there are two main types of solar PV panel: monocrystalline (mono) and polycrystalline (poly). Monocrystalline solar panels are made of single crystal silicon whereas polycrystalline solar panels are made of up solar cells with lots of silicon fragments melted together. Individual efficiencies of a polycrystalline silicon PV cell versus

The silicon photovoltaic (PV) solar cell is one of the technologies are dominating the PV market. The mono-Si solar cell is the most efficient of the solar cells into the silicon range. The efficiency of the single-junction terrestrial crystalline silicon PV cell is around 26% today (Green et al., 2019, Green et al., 2020).

What are photovoltaic cells?: types and applications

The functioning of photovoltaic cells is based on the photovoltaic effect. When the sunlight hits semiconductor materials such as silicon, the photons (light particles) impact the electrons of these materials, releasing them and generating an electric current. How do polycrystalline solar panels work?

Polycrystalline solar panels work by absorbing solar energy and converting it into power. They consist of numerous photovoltaic cells, each containing multiple silicon crystals that facilitate electron movement.

How are polycrystalline solar cells made?

To create the wafers for the panel, producers melt several silicon shards together rather than using a single silicon crystal. This process is used to make polycrystalline solar cells, which are also known as multi-crystalline or many-crystal silicon solar cells.

How has Huawei influenced large-scale PV development?

Huawei has ushered in a new era for large-scale PV development, with string inverters now selected as a mainstream option in utility-scale projects, which were previously dominated by central inverters. Large-scale PV has also evolved in another way: Bifacial modules coupled with tracking systems are increasingly part of the sys-tem design.
